Chief of Staff Sirsky sent a working group to the 59th Separate Motorized Infantry Brigade to check the circumstances of the casualties

Serhii Syrskyi, the commander of the United Forces of Ukraine, decided to send a working group to the 59th Separate Motorized Infantry Brigade in order to thoroughly check and clarify the circumstances of the recent losses among the personnel of this military unit.

This is reported by the General Staff.

The day before, paramedic Kateryna Polishchuk (Ptashka) accused the command of the brigade of "deliberate negligence, criminal orders, disregard for the life and health of personnel", which led to the "death of a large number of servicemen".

She specifically blames commander Bohdan Shevchuk, who was appointed to the position in April, as she claims, due to his "family ties" with the top military leadership.

He says that due to his "selfishness, blind careerism, removal of all "disagreeing" commanders, suppression of morale and humiliation of personnel with complete indifference to the main goal of the servicemen, not only fighters died, but also representatives of high management positions.
